VsFTPD is a small and easy-to-use FTP server program. This article allows beginners to learn the simplest vsftpd server setup in Ubuntu in the shortest time.
Installation instructions
$ Sudo apt-get install vsftpd
Settings after installation
/Etc/vsftpd. conf
This file does not seem to be added by default. This file has special purposes. The users listed in this file will not be restricted by directories when using ftp again.
/Etc/vsftpd. chroot_list
Anonymous_enable = NO
Allow arbitrary user connections
Local_enable = YES
Allow local users to log on to FTP?
Write_enable = YES
Whether to enable write permission
Chroot_local_user = YES
Chroot_list_enable = YES
Chroot_list_file =/etc/vsftpd. chroot_list
Chroot_local_user = YES
Chroot_list_enable = YES
This setting prevents all users from changing the root directory except those listed in/etc/vsftpd. chroot_list.
Restart vsftp
Sudo/etc/init. d/vsftpd restart
